NCT ID: NCT05608057 Completed - Clinical trials for Gingival Pigmentation

Vitamin C Mesotherapy Versus Diode Laser for the Management of Physiologic Gingival Pigmentation

Start date: October 22, 2022
Phase: N/A
Study type: Interventional

Physiologic pigmentation affects the gingival esthetics. Laser ablation has been recently used as the most effective and reliable technique for gingival depigmentation. However, the high cost of laser technology limits its use in dental practice. Vitamin C/Ascorbic acid mesotherapy has been proposed as a minimally invasive, safe, cost-effective new modality of treatment.

NCT ID: NCT05283668 Completed - Clinical trials for Gingival Pigmentation

Effect of Injectable Platelet Rich Fibrin on Healing and Patient Satisfaction Following Laser Gingival Depigmentation

Start date: February 20, 2020
Phase: Phase 4
Study type: Interventional

The objectives of the present study are to: 1. Evaluate the effect of I-PRF injection following laser gingival depigmentation technique on the healing period as a primary objective. 2. Assess patient satisfaction following the procedure in terms of pain and esthetic outcome as a secondary objective.
